Elizabeth Anne Richard was born in 1644 in Chowan, North Carolina, United States, the child of Michael Richards Jr And Mary Anne Jones. Elizabeth Anne Richard married Richard Odom Sr, and had children including Abraham Odom. Elizabeth Anne Richard passed away in 1727 in Chowan, North Carolina, United States.
